3 Signs You Need Electrical Repair

  • Frequent Circuit Breaker Trips: If your breakers keep tripping, it’s a sign that your system is overloaded or a circuit is shorting out. This repeated issue often points to outdated wiring or damaged connections that need immediate inspection. Ignoring frequent trips can lead to overheating, which raises the risk of electrical fires. A licensed professional can determine the cause and restore your system’s stability before serious damage occurs.
  • Flickering Lights or Power Fluctuations: Lights that dim or flicker when appliances are used indicate voltage instability. This could be caused by loose wiring, corroded connections, or an overtaxed electrical panel. These issues not only affect comfort but can also damage sensitive electronics. Addressing them promptly through professional electrical repair ensures consistent, safe power flow throughout your home.
  • Warm Outlets or Burning Smells: Outlets that feel hot to the touch or produce a faint burning odor are major red flags. This typically means wires are overheating behind the wall due to poor insulation or faulty connections. Continuing to use these outlets can lead to melted wiring or even electrical fires. Call a repair professional immediately to prevent further damage and restore safety to your living space.

Frequently Asked Questions About Electrical Repair

How can I tell if I need electrical repair?

Signs such as flickering lights, frequent breaker trips, or discolored outlets usually indicate a problem. If you notice any of these issues, it’s time to call a licensed electrician.

Is DIY electrical repair safe?

Electrical systems carry significant risks if handled improperly. It’s always safer to hire a professional with the right tools and training to complete repairs safely and effectively.

How often should I have my wiring inspected?

Experts recommend a professional electrical inspection every 3–5 years, especially for older homes or those with high electrical usage.

Can repairs help lower my energy bill?

Yes, repairing faulty circuits and improving energy efficiency can reduce unnecessary power waste and help lower monthly bills.
